About this Modpack
Legacy Console Experience is a modpack made to bring back that old feeling of turning on you xbox 360 and inserting the minecraft disc in it(although it isn't an exact replica) by mimicking the user interface, textures, sounds and that sort of stuff, enjoy!
But wait there's still stuff missing as i couldn't find anything to replicate it with:
- Crafting menu's still missing as i cannot find anything to edit it with
- World creation screen in 1.19.4, because the changes made to it don't allow fancymenu support at the same level
- The gamma( the shader is there, it's just disabled by default because it destroys fps)
- 1 to 1 recreation because there needed to be a lot of cut corners to fit fancymenu
- The elytra roll, because the Cool Elytra Mod isn't updated to 1.19.4

Legacy Console Experience server crashes or won't start – what to do?
Most common causes: insufficient RAM or wrong fabric loader. Check latest.log for "OutOfMemoryError" → increase RAM to at least 6 GB. For "Mixin" or "ClassNotFoundException" errors: modpack version and loader don't match. Legacy Console Experience server lagging – performance tips
1) Increase RAM to 6 GB+. 2) Reduce server view-distance to 8 (server.properties). 3) Pre-generate chunks with the "Chunky" plugin. 4) Use /spark profiler to check which mods consume the most tick time.
